How it feels

The film shows groups of pilgrims riding a cable car in Nepal. Each trip is filmed continuously from the same angle inside the car as the passengers travel to a temple.

What happens

Manakamana is a 2013 documentary film directed by Stephanie Spray and Pacho Velez of the Sensory Ethnography Lab at Harvard University. It is an experimental documentary about pilgrims traveling on the Manakamana Cable Car between Cheres, Chitwan and the Manakamana Temple in Nepal. The film has been acquired for U.S. distribution by The Cinema Guild.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
